Southeast Idaho fire crews prep for dry, potentially busy wildfire season

Summary by KIFI
IDAHO FALLS, Idaho (KIFI)– Fire officials say the upcoming wildfire season in Idaho is shaping up to be a busy one, driven by an extremely dry winter and changing weather patterns. The abnormal conditions are already raising concerns across Southeast Idaho, and wildfire season hasn't even reached its peak yet.
